Nick,
we used to use a woody plant poison to help control lantana on our farm. I think it was called Grazon which targets only the woody plants and not the grasses. Roundup tends to nuke everything. The poison needs to be applied when the plants are actively growing(usually Dec- april from memory)
We never cut back the lantana, just sprayed it, much easier when you have lots of it.Good luck, you’ll need it.
